最新科技趋势:AI在软件开发中的应用增长迅猛
2025/08/02 14:09:57
随着人工智能技术的不断发展,AI在软件开发中的应用正以前所未有的速度增长。特别是在上海及其周边地区,这一趋势尤为明显。越来越多的企业开始将AI集成到他们的开发流程中,以提高效率、降低成本并创造更多价值。
AI在软件开发中的应用
AI技术在软件开发中的应用主要体现在以下几个方面:
- 代码生成与优化: 使用AI工具可以自动生成代码片段,减少开发者的工作量。此外,AI还可以帮助优化现有代码,提高代码质量和性能。
- 自动化测试: AI可以自动识别和生成测试用例,显著提高测试覆盖率和效率。这对于确保软件质量至关重要。
- 缺陷检测与修复: 利用机器学习算法,AI能够快速检测出代码中的潜在缺陷,并提供修复建议。这不仅提高了软件的稳定性,还减少了后期维护成本。
- 需求分析与预测: 通过分析用户行为数据和市场趋势,AI可以帮助企业更好地理解客户需求,从而做出更明智的产品决策。
上海及周边地区的AI应用案例
上海作为中国的经济中心之一,拥有众多高科技企业和创新园区。这些企业在推动AI技术的发展和应用方面起到了重要作用。例如:
位于张江高科技园区的一家软件开发公司,通过引入AI驱动的自动化测试工具,成功将测试周期缩短了50%以上。这不仅提高了产品质量,还大幅降低了人力成本。
另一家位于漕河泾开发区的金融科技企业,则利用AI进行风险评估和信用评分,大大提升了业务处理的速度和准确性。这种技术的应用使得该公司在激烈的市场竞争中脱颖而出。
面临的挑战与未来展望
尽管AI在软件开发中的应用带来了诸多好处,但也存在一些挑战:
- 数据隐私与安全: 随着大量数据的收集和处理,如何保护用户的隐私和确保数据安全成为一个重要问题。
- 技术门槛: 对于许多中小企业而言,引入AI技术需要投入较高的成本和技术支持,这对他们来说可能是一个障碍。
- 人才短缺: AI领域的专业人才相对稀缺,招聘和培养相关人才是企业面临的一个挑战。
然而,随着技术的不断进步和政策的支持,这些问题有望逐步得到解决。政府和行业组织也在积极推动AI技术的研发和应用,为企业的数字化转型提供更多的支持。
结语
AI在软件开发中的应用正逐渐成为一种新常态。上海及其周边地区的企业通过积极拥抱这一技术,不仅提高了自身的竞争力,也为整个行业的发展做出了贡献。未来,随着更多创新成果的涌现,AI将在软件开发领域发挥更加重要的作用。
